About (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ine
(3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ine (PubChem CID 90396298) has the molecular formula C15H21N
and a molecular weight of 215.34 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ine.

What is the SMILES notation for (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ine?
The canonical SMILES for (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ine is C[C@H]1CC=CC(C2=NC[C@@H](C)CC=C2)=CC1.
What is the InChIKey of (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ine?
The InChIKey is ZWLZAVSXYWRLMO-STQMWFEESA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C15H21N/c1-12-5-3-7-14(10-9-12)15-8-4-6-13(2)11-16-15/h3-4,7-8,10,12-13H,5-6,9,11H2,1-2H3/t12-,13-/m0/s1.
What are the key properties of (3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ine?
(3S)-3-methyl-7-[(4S)-4-methylcyclohepta-1,6-dien-1-yl]-3,4-dihydro-2H-azepine has a molecular weight of 215.34 g/mol, XLogP of 3.94, 1 rotatable bonds, 0 hydrogen bond donors, and 1 hydrogen bond acceptors.
